2. Best Cash Home Buyers

Selling a home traditionally can be time-consuming, involving repairs, open houses, and negotiations. If you want a faster option, best Cash Home Buyers offer a quick and hassle-free way to sell.

  • Top cash home buyers provide competitive offers without hidden fees.

  • Reliable cash home buyers ensure a transparent and secure transaction.

  • Trusted cash property buyers often purchase homes “as-is,” eliminating repair costs.

  • Best cash offer for homes can be negotiated to match market value.

  • Local cash home buyers have in-depth knowledge of area market trends.

  • Professional cash buyers handle the paperwork and closing process quickly.

  • Cash home buying companies often close deals in as little as a week.

This option is ideal for homeowners facing financial hardship, job relocation, or those who simply want to skip the traditional listing process.

3. Fix and Flip Loans

If you are an investor or a homeowner looking to renovate and resell a property, Fix and Flip Loans provide the capital you need for purchase and repairs.

  • Short-term fix and flip financing gives you funds for quick property turnarounds.

  • Renovation loans for real estate cover both purchase and upgrade costs.

  • Fix and flip funding options vary depending on your project size and timeline.

  • Hard money fix and flip loans offer fast approvals, often based on property value rather than credit score.

  • Fix and flip loan lenders specialize in working with property investors.

  • House flipping loans are designed for projects with a quick resale plan.

  • Rehab loans for investors provide flexible terms to cover extensive renovations.

  • Real estate rehab financing ensures you have the budget to transform outdated homes.

FAQs

Q1: What’s the main benefit of using downsizing real estate specialists?
A: They streamline the process, help find a home that fits your lifestyle, and ensure you get the best value for your current property.

Q2: How fast can cash home buyers close a deal?
A: Many local cash home buyers can close within 7–14 days.

Q3: Are fix and flip loans only for professional investors?
A: No, even first-time flippers can apply, but they should have a solid plan and budget in place.

Q4: What’s the difference between a multifamily mortgage and a standard mortgage?
A: A multifamily property mortgage is designed for buildings with multiple units, while a standard mortgage is usually for single-family homes.
